Halloween Table Decor Idea from Making

Halloween is just around the corner and are you keen to add something special to your halloween decor? I picked up this idea from Making Memories from the Spellbound Collection and using Slice Cordless Design Digital Cutter. Happy decor making!
To create this project, do the following:
1. Cut a 8.5” x 8.5” piece of Making Memories’ Spellbound glitter dot black paper and use the Slice to cut a 3-inch pumpkin (from the Spellbound Design Card) on the bottom right corner. Fold the paper in half.

Quickutz Silhouette: Digital Craft Cutter

Still looking for that craft cutter that you can invest in? Do you think it’s the Quickutz Silhouette?
The Quickutz Silhouette Digital Craft Cutter is designed for crafters who:
*Have a PC with Windows 2000 or XP
*Have an internet connection
*Want to cut out Quickutz designs and computer fonts in multiple sizes
*Don’t want to worry about cartridges or CDs
*Want to explore advanced features of digital craft cutting
